Article Summary

Vision-Language-Action (VLA) models have demonstrated strong performance across diverse robotic manipulation tasks, yet their predominantly vision-centric perception and position-controlled execution remain insufficient for contact-rich manipulation. Visual observations alone often provide limited evidence of contact onset and interaction magnitude, while position-control policies cannot respond compliantly to rapidly changing contact dynamics. To bridge both the perception and control gaps, we propose TAO-Force, a force-conditioned VLA framework that combines force-aware policy learning with contact-regulated execution. For force-aware perception, TAO-Force introduces Force-conditioned Feature-wise Linear Modulation (F-FiLM) to inject encoded force feedback into the representations of a frozen pretrained visual-language backbone while preserving its semantic priors. For responsive control, it employs a contact-gated fast-slow architecture, with a slow position-control branch tracking nominal trajectories during non-contact phases and a fast admittance-control branch regulating physical interaction during contact phases. Detailed analyses on a force-perception task and real-world evaluations across four contact-rich manipulation tasks validate the effectiveness and robustness of TAO-Force.
